Walworth awards $16,600 contract for cemetery GPR and mapping; cemetery committee schedules headstone-cleaning class
Summary
The board approved a $16,600 agreement with Sentry Mapping for ground-penetrating radar (GPR) and digital mapping of town cemeteries and the Town Clerk reported a June 20 headstone-cleaning class at West Walworth Cemetery.

The Walworth Town Board voted June 18 to authorize the Town Supervisor to execute a professional services agreement with Sentry Mapping for ground-penetrating radar (GPR) surveys and digital mapping of town-owned cemeteries at a cost of $16,600.
The town solicited competitive proposals from three vendors: Sentry Mapping ($16,600), ViaVista Mapping ($28,375), and GeoModel, Inc. ($19,800). After reviewing scope and price, the board determined Sentry Mapping provided best value and authorized the Supervisor to sign the contract, with funding to come from the Records Management reserve (AA.00.1410.485).
Town Clerk Nadine Seppeler noted the Cemetery Committee met June 9 and discussed a headstone-cleaning class led by Kaite DeRado scheduled for June 20 at West Walworth Cemetery and that the committee expects to have final approval of the GPR project at the current meeting. The board adopted the Sentry Mapping agreement by roll call vote.
